What Is a Crypto Casino?
A crypto casino is an Best Online Crypto Casino gambling site that uses blockchain‑based currencies for deposits, wagers, and withdrawals. Unlike conventional online casinos, which depend on fiat methods such as charge card, bank transfers, or e‑wallets, crypto gambling establishments let users transact straight in digital possessions like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), Litecoin (LTC), or newer tokens such as Solana (SOL) and Polygon (MATIC).
The core facility is basic: gamers fund their accounts by sending out crypto from a personal wallet to the casino's address, receive a matching balance in the platform's internal journal, and after that play casino games using that balance. When a player wins, the Casino Crypto can credit the internal balance, which is later withdrawn to the gamer's external wallet.
How Crypto Casinos Operate
- Account Creation-- Users register with an email and produce a password. Some platforms also request a username and optional KYC (Know Your Customer) verification.
- Wallet Funding-- The player moves the selected cryptocurrency to the casino's public address. The majority of websites show a QR code or a string of characters for easy copying.
- Internal Ledger-- Upon verification of the blockchain transaction, the casino updates the user's account with a matching amount (often in the exact same crypto, though some sites transform to a stablecoin for simpler wagering).
- Gameplay-- Players can wager on a wide selection of video games-- fruit machine, table video games, live dealer video games, and even sportsbook markets-- utilizing the crypto balance.
- Payments-- Withdrawals are processed by sending the staying balance from the casino's hot or cold wallet to the gamer's external address. Withdrawal speeds vary by blockchain blockage and the casino's internal policies.
Benefits of Crypto Casinos
- Privacy-- Since blockchain deals do not require personal banking information, gamers can enjoy a greater degree of privacy.
- Speed-- Deposits and withdrawals frequently complete within minutes, especially for cryptocurrencies with quick block times.
- Lower Fees-- The absence of intermediary payment processors can lower deal expenses for both the casino and the gamer.
- International Access-- Crypto runs throughout borders, making it easier for players in areas where traditional online gambling is limited or heavily managed.
- Provably Fair Gaming-- Many crypto casinos utilize cryptographic algorithms that permit gamers to confirm the fairness of each game outcome.
Possible Risks and Regulatory Concerns
While the benefits are luring, players must know the following difficulties:
| Risk | Description |
|---|
| Volatility | Crypto values can swing drastically; a gamer's balance may be worth substantially less (or more) by the time they squander. |
| Regulatory Ambiguity | Many jurisdictions treat crypto betting as a gray area. Some countries outright ban it, while others enforce strict licensing requirements. |
| Security Threats | Hot wallets are susceptible to hacks; players should guarantee they utilize platforms with robust security measures, such as two‑factor authentication (2FA) and cold storage for funds. |
| Absence of Recourse | Unlike fiat transactions, crypto transfers are irreparable. Disputes with an unregulated casino can be challenging to fix. |
